Tomato Spring Canyon
Tomato Spring Canyon is a valley in Orange County, Southern California, California and has an elevation of 479 feet. Tomato Spring Canyon is situated nearby to the suburb Stonegate, as well as near the hamlet Serrano Place.Places of Interest

Portola High School
School
Portola High School is one of five public high schools in the Irvine Unified School District and is located in Irvine, California. The groundbreaking ceremony was held in October 2014 and the school opened in August 2016.
James A. Musick Facility
Prison
James A. Musick Facility is a minimum-security county jail in south Orange County, California. The county jail is on an unincorporated pocket of land, surrounded by the city of Irvine on three sides and bordered by Lake Forest's Bake Parkway to the southeast.

Foothill Ranch
Suburb

Foothill Ranch is a neighborhood of the city of Lake Forest in Orange County, California, United States. The population was 10,899 at the 2000 census. The master planned community was a census-designated place prior to being incorporated into the city in 2000. Foothill Ranch is situated 2½ miles east of Tomato Spring Canyon.
Lake Forest

Lake Forest is a city in Orange County in Southern California. It used to be known as El Toro after the Marine Corps training station, which has closed. The city is largely suburban with parks and industrial areas. Foothill Ranch lies within the city limits.
Northwood
Suburb
Northwood is a community encompassing the northern portions of the city of Irvine, in Orange County, California. It covers the area enclosed by the Santa Ana Freeway, Culver Drive, Portola Parkway and Jeffrey Road. Northwood is situated 4 miles northwest of Tomato Spring Canyon.
